Honestly, we’re not joking at all; this wooden two-seater was created by a furniture maker named…Friend Wood! Boy, this guy must really cherish his African mahogany! Mr. Wood based the Tryane II on the chassis and the mechanicals of a Citroen 2CV using the French car’s 0,6-liter engine. Weighing in at 900lb / 408 kg, the Tryane II can go up to 101 mph (162 km/h), but to be honest, this is something we’d never attempt in this wacky woodie! Via: Dailymail
